Block 1,022,627
Block Hash
856830ef8cc2f24aae321cf081df0714645436cd0ed3b8319e4e0e4e77
b3dbc6
Previous Block Hash
87ba156512b0b1d17128db84e4ac08671be00aa069709b4340ea83a9ea 46cfee
Mined
Transactions
3
Difficulty
35.22 M
Size
624 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
131,990.58933605
PEPE
1 input, 2 outputs
119,730.4998
PEPE